A sunscreen sample that looked like a ‘protection pack’: How SunScoop turned packaging into a talking point

SunScoop has launched a marketing campaign featuring sunscreen samples in packaging labeled as a 'Protection Pack' to create curiosity and social media engagement. The campaign uses humor and clever branding to promote sun safety while encouraging organic sharing.
Why it matters
It illustrates modern marketing strategies that leverage internet culture and unconventional packaging to drive brand awareness.
By combining humour, quick commerce, and internet culture, SunScoop has introduced a quirky campaign designed to get people talking about sun protection.
